How Long Will a House Stay Cool Without Power?

In general, a well-insulated home in moderate temperatures can stay cool for about 4-6 hours without power. However, this time frame can vary depending on the factors mentioned above. If it’s a particularly hot day or your home is poorly insulated, it may start to heat up much faster.

Guidelines to keep the house cool 

The heat of summer means that we cannot even be well at home, often being forced to use the air conditioning. Lowering the blinds, changing the sheets or controlling body temperature are some of the tips to combat high temperatures at home.

In the hot season, it is advisable to adopt a routine . Open the windows first thing in the morning and when the sun sets in the afternoons, these are the hours of lowest temperatures , in this way, you will be able to clean the space and let fresh air into your house.

In addition to keeping the home cool , it is essential to maintain a regulated body temperature , constantly hydrate , wear appropriate clothing , and get your wrists or neck wet , which are areas where our body temperature drops.

Another trick to keep your house ventilated is to keep electrical appliances such as the washing machine off during the hottest hours of the day . These devices generate a lot of energy that is released as heat. A dishwasher, for example, can increase the temperature by up to 2ºC . It is also advisable to close the doors of the rooms when these appliances are working.

Keeping curtains and blinds closed is key during the hottest hours . This way you prevent hot air and UV rays from entering . You also create spaces with shade and without direct sunlight , with this you will ensure that the fresh air stays longer.

Did you know that incandescent lights spend 90% of their energy on the heat they give off ? Therefore, if you have not yet decided, it is a good time to switch to LEDs.
